Movie Review: Avengers: Age of Ultron (2015)

Marvel Comics is out with another Avengers, and this is as exciting as the first.  I thought I might hit overload with all the action taking place.  However this movie also has some humor and some drama mixed in.  We discover that Hawkeye (Jeremy Renner) has a family.  The Hulk (Mark Ruffalo) is still caught up with "I can't trust myself," and Iron Man (Robert Downing Jr.) is not willing to listen to anyone's advise, which gets him in  trouble as Ultron (James Spader) is born.  Black Widow (Scarlett Johansson) is in love with the Hulk, and using this love to control him, at times.  We learn more about all of the Avengers, (other than Hawkeye) when they are put under mind control by a new nemesis, Scarlet Witch (Elizabeth Olsen).  Another nemesis is the the witch's twin, Quicksilver (Aaron Taylor-Johnson) who has incredible speed.  Thor (Chris Hemsworth) also deals with past issues so he is more effective in the present.  Captain America (Chris Evans) is everyone's favorite leader.  He too deals with issues of having outlived his time.  We are also introduced to a new character, Vision (Paul Bettany) who is the physical version of Iron man's computer, Jarvis.  Fury (Samuel Jackson) also shows up, and his support is needed in the end.  This movie is lots of fun as our heroes try to save the world with as little collateral damage as possible.
